JAKARTA - BOYZ'S BALLISTICS from EXILE TRIBE show their Indonesian language skills in their second appearance in front of fans in Indonesia. This time through the Asian Sound Syndicate (ASS) Vol.2 music festival in Jakarta, Sunday afternoon. The vocal group, dance and rap from Japan greets fans, "Good afternoon, we are BOYZ's BALLISTIK. Indonesia is really cool" In the introductory session, the group members, apart from mentioning their respective names, also inserted words or phrases in Indonesian. For example, Fukahori Miku personnel said, "I'm Miku, don't like us? Me too." Miku said as quoted by Antara. Meanwhile, another personnel, Hidaka Ryuta, said, "Good afternoon, I'm Ryuta. Great. Great Boyz", then Matsui Riki said, "I love you. Very cool". Another BOYZ BALLISTIK personnel, Sunada Masahiro admitted that he was honored to be back performing in Indonesia and then representing his group expressed his gratitude to those present to witness the performance of him and the team. "Two times we have appeared in Indonesia. We are honored to be invited here. Thank you for coming. Are you guys hot? It's okay, don't forget to drink," said Masahiro. BOYZ's BALLISTICS consist of seven personnel namely Sunada Masahiro, Hidaka Ryuta, Kano Yoshiyuki, Kaiuma Ryusei, Fukahori Miku, Okuda Rikiya and Matsui Riki opened their appearance in Jakarta by singing the song "Ding Ding Dong", one of the songs on the new album of the same name and released in May 2023. They then continued their appearance by singing "VIVA LA EVOLUCION", "We Never Die", "Last Dance ni Bye Bye", "Animal", "SUMMER HYPE", "Most Wanted", "Front Burner", "Make U a Believer", and "PASION". "Drop Dead" is the closing song and ends the show for approximately 30 minutes from the TRIBE EXILE junior group. After appearing they said goodbye to the fans who were present and then went to the back stage.
